1. API Description

Domain name for API request: as.intl.tencentcloudapi.com.

This API is used to modify the cloud load balancers of a scaling group.

  • This API can specify a new cloud load balancer configuration for the scaling group. The new configuration overwrites the original load balancer configuration.
  • To clear the cloud load balancer of the scaling group, specify only the scaling group ID but not the specific cloud load balancer.
  • This API modifies the cloud load balancer of the scaling group and generate a scaling activity to asynchronously modify the cloud load balancers of existing instances.

A maximum of 20 requests can be initiated per second for this API.

2. Input Parameters

The following request parameter list only provides API request parameters and some common parameters. For the complete common parameter list, see Common Request Parameters.

Parameter Name Required Type Description
Action Yes String Common Params. The value used for this API: ModifyLoadBalancers.
Version Yes String Common Params. The value used for this API: 2018-04-19.
Region Yes String Common Params. For more information, please see the list of regions supported by the product.
AutoScalingGroupId Yes String Scaling group ID. you can obtain the scaling group ID by logging in to the console or calling the api DescribeAutoScalingGroups and retrieving the AutoScalingGroupId from the returned information.
LoadBalancerIds.N No Array of String List of classic clb ids. currently, the maximum length is 20. you cannot specify LoadBalancerIds and ForwardLoadBalancers at the same time. it can be obtained through the DescribeLoadBalancers api.
ForwardLoadBalancers.N No Array of ForwardLoadBalancer Specifies the list of load balancers with a current maximum length of 100. either LoadBalancerIds or ForwardLoadBalancers can be specified at the same time. can be obtained through the DescribeLoadBalancers api.
LoadBalancersCheckPolicy No String CLB verification policy. Valid values: ALL and DIFF. Default value: ALL.
  • ALL: The CLB passes the verification only when all CLB parameters are valid. Otherwise, a verification error occurs.
  • DIFF: The CLB passes the verification only when the CLB parameters with changes are valid. Otherwise, a verification error occurs.
  • 3. Output Parameters

    Parameter Name Type Description
    ActivityId String Scaling activity ID
    RequestId String The unique request ID, generated by the server, will be returned for every request (if the request fails to reach the server for other reasons, the request will not obtain a RequestId). RequestId is required for locating a problem.

    4. Example

    Example1 Clearing Load Balancers of Scaling Groups

    Input Example

    POST / HTTP/1.1
    Host: as.intl.tencentcloudapi.com
    Content-Type: application/json
    X-TC-Action: ModifyLoadBalancers
    <Common request parameters>
    
    {
        "AutoScalingGroupId": "asg-12wjuh0s"
    }

    Output Example

    {
        "Response": {
            "ActivityId": "asa-rp63a5q8",
            "RequestId": "7de5a82f-b781-4302-b723-e7a879c20767"
        }
    }

    Example2 Modifying Load Balancers of Scaling Groups to Classic Load Balancers lb-crhgatrf

    Input Example

    POST / HTTP/1.1
    Host: as.intl.tencentcloudapi.com
    Content-Type: application/json
    X-TC-Action: ModifyLoadBalancers
    <Common request parameters>
    
    {
        "AutoScalingGroupId": "asg-12wjuh0s",
        "LoadBalancerIds": [
            "lb-crhgatrf"
        ]
    }

    Output Example

    {
        "Response": {
            "ActivityId": "asa-67izy66g",
            "RequestId": "bd3c91e8-3051-4c02-ac58-54d47b9c9d63"
        }
    }

    Example3 Modifying Load Balancers of Scaling Groups to Application-based Load Balancer lb-23aejgcv with Listener lbl-ncw704sn

    Input Example

    POST / HTTP/1.1
    Host: as.intl.tencentcloudapi.com
    Content-Type: application/json
    X-TC-Action: ModifyLoadBalancers
    <Common request parameters>
    
    {
        "AutoScalingGroupId": "asg-12wjuh0s",
        "ForwardLoadBalancers": [
            {
                "TargetAttributes": [
                    {
                        "Port": 8080,
                        "Weight": 10
                    }
                ],
                "Region": "ap-guangzhou",
                "LocationId": "loc-l3hmaev9",
                "ListenerId": "lbl-ncw704sn",
                "LoadBalancerId": "lb-23aejgcv"
            }
        ]
    }

    Output Example

    {
        "Response": {
            "ActivityId": "asa-9asddelc",
            "RequestId": "8d78668d-61eb-456d-855b-f34f91371089"
        }
    }

    6. Error Code

    The following only lists the error codes related to the API business logic. For other error codes, see Common Error Codes.

    Error Code Description
    FailedOperation.NoActivityToGenerate No scaling activity is generated.
    InternalError.CallLbError CLB API call failed.
    InternalError.RequestError An internal request error occurred.
    InvalidParameter.ActionNotFound Invalid Action request.
    InvalidParameter.Conflict Multiple parameters specified conflict and cannot co-exist.
    InvalidParameter.InScenario The parameter is invalid in a specific scenario.
    InvalidParameterValue.ClassicLb A classic CLB should be specified.
    InvalidParameterValue.DuplicatedForwardLb Duplicate CLB instances
    InvalidParameterValue.ForwardLb A CLB should be specified.
    InvalidParameterValue.InvalidAutoScalingGroupId Invalid scaling group ID.
    InvalidParameterValue.InvalidClbRegion The regions specified for CLB is invalid.
    InvalidParameterValue.LbProjectInconsistent The load balancer is in a different project.
    InvalidParameterValue.LimitExceeded The value exceeds the limit.
    InvalidParameterValue.Range The value is outside the specified range.
    InvalidParameterValue.TargetPortDuplicated The backend port of the CLB layer-4 listener already exists.
    MissingParameter.InScenario A parameter is missing in a specific scenario.
    ResourceNotFound.AutoScalingGroupNotFound The scaling group does not exist.
    ResourceNotFound.ListenerNotFound The specified listener does not exist.
    ResourceNotFound.LoadBalancerNotFound The specified load balancer was not found.
    ResourceNotFound.LocationNotFound The specified location does not exist.
    ResourceUnavailable.AutoScalingGroupInActivity The auto scaling group is active.
    ResourceUnavailable.LbBackendRegionInconsistent The backend region of the CLB is not the same as the one for AS service.
    ResourceUnavailable.LbVpcInconsistent The CLB and scaling group should reside in the same VPC.
    ResourceUnavailable.LoadBalancerInOperation CLB is active in the scaling group.
